Mark Buehrle Throws Perfect Game Against Rays

Mark Buehrle of the Chicago White Sox threw a perfect game today against the Tampa Bay Rays. The perfect game was saved when White Sox outfielder Dewayne Wise robbed Gabe Kapler of a home run in the 9th with an amazing catch. Wise entered the game in the 9th as a defensive substitution. It was the 18th perfect game in MLB history and the first since Randy Johnson's in 2004. Buehrle has one previous no-hitter in his career.

Lester's Playoff Tune-up

The Sox hit the ground running and racked up 5 runs in the 1st two innings of today’s game, starting with an Ellsbury single on the 2nd pitch he saw. Given that cushion, Lester toyed with the Tribe for the rest of the game, flirting with history yet again. Except for 1 pitch, that 1 lousy pitch, ball #4 to Kelly Shoppach, Lester had a perfect game through 5 innings! No hits, no WP’s, no HBP, no errors, just that 1 pitch. He ended up with an interesting line: 6 IP, 2 hits, 1 BB, 1 ER, 1 WP, 1 Balk, 1 HBP, 4 K’s, 86 pitches (55 for strikes.) In a breakout season- which was highlighted by a no-hitter against KC in May- he finished with a 16-6 record and a 3.21 ERA. He also produced his staff-leading 20th quality start. Tito is keeping his main guys in the ‘pen sharp: Masterson came in for the 7th, Oki in the 8th, and Pap in the 9th. Those three combined for a perfect final 3 innings with 0 BB’s, 0 hits, 0 runs, and 1 K each. Offensively, Ellsbury, Lowrie, and Youk each had 2 hits and each scored 2 runs, including Youk’s #28 ‘tater.
